The bike is fitted what I understand to be called a Chinamo, but has always seemed to produce a high charging current (3 to 4 amps) when cruising no matter what state the battery charge is. I have checked the calibration on the ammeter and it is pretty accurate. The last time I was out the battery got quite hot and packed in altogether, a previous larger battery was found to be slightly swollen when replaced.
I initially thought it may have been the voltage regulator and replaced this with a modern electronic type but did not seem to make any difference to the charging current shown on the ammeter.
Is this level of charging current normal?, grateful for any advice
